Explain the importance of quality assurance and testing in software product development.
Q: Explain the potential impact of voice and conversational interfaces on web development in the…
A: In today’s world, voice and conversational interfaces have revolutionized the way interact with…
Q: How does responsive web design impact the design and testing phases of web development?
A: Responsive web design is a technique aimed at creating web pages that can adapt seamlessly to screen…
Q: Explain the importance of planning and analysis in the web development process.
A: In web development careful planning and analysis play a role.Before diving into coding and design it…
Q: Explain the importance of version control systems and continuous integration in the web development…
A: Collaboration and Teamwork: In web development, multiple team members often work on the same project…
Q: How can version control systems (e.g., Git) be used effectively in web development projects?
A: It needs a strong system to monitor, manage, and coordinate changes in the complex field of web…
Q: Discuss different software deployment strategies, such as on-premises, cloud-based, and SaaS…
A: When it comes to delivering software applications to user’s software deployment plays a role. It…
Q: Explain the Von Neumann architecture and its significance in modern computer systems.
A: The von Neumann architecture is a critical conceptual framework for developing and implementing…
Q: What are the key considerations when selecting a web development outsourcing partner?
A: When it comes to selecting a web development outsourcing partner there are factors that need to be…
Q: True or False, Intel processors handles instructions one at a time. True False
A: The correct solution for the above mentioned question is given in the next steps.
Q: How does the deployment phase differ from the development phase in web development?
A: Web development involves a process that consists of phases each serving its own purposes and…
Q: Explain the significance of automated testing and continuous integration in ensuring software…
A: In the realm of modern software development, ensuring the highest level of quality is paramount.…
Q: Discuss the importance of DNS (Domain Name System) in the functioning of the internet and elaborate…
A: The Domain Name System (DNS) is a part of the internet as it acts as a distributed database.Its main…
Q: Discuss the role of routers in packet-switched networks and their impact on data transmission.
A: 1) Routers are networking devices that play a pivotal role in directing data traffic between…
Q: What are software products, and how do they differ from custom software solutions?
A: Software encompasses computer programs, data, and instructions that empower computers and electronic…
Q: Explain the purpose of a motherboard and its various components in a computer system.
A: A crucial part of a computer system is the motherboard, also known as the mainboard or system board.…
Q: What are the key phases involved in the development of a software product?
A: Software product development follows a systematic approach encompassing crucial stages.These stages…
Q: Discuss the role of user feedback and customer-centric design in the evolution of software products.
A: The evolution of software products heavily relies on the input, from users and a design approach…
Q: Explain the importance of requirements gathering and analysis in software product development.
A: Requirements gathering and analysis are foundational steps in the software development process, akin…
Q: Implement a program where two threads print even and odd numbers alternatively.
A: [ Note: As per our policy guidelines, in case of multiple different questions, we are allowed to…
Q: Provide examples of inclusive design practices that improve web accessibility.
A: Inclusive design practices for web accessibility are essential for ensuring that websites are usable…
Q: Discuss the challenges associated with scaling and maintaining software products as they grow in…
A: Scaling and maintaining software products as they grow in user base and complexity present a unique…
Q: What are some important metrics used to measure the success and quality of software products?
A: Software metrics play a role in evaluating the success and quality of software products.They supply…
Q: Describe the purpose of ARP (Address Resolution Protocol) in Ethernet networks.
A: We are going first to understand what ARP does and how it work and we will then know what purpose…
Q: Discuss the role of APIs (Application Programming Interfaces) in the integration phase of web…
A: APIs, also known as Application Programming Interfaces, play a role during the integration phase of…
Q: Explain the significance of service-level agreements (SLAs) in web development outsourcing…
A: Service-Level Agreements (SLAs) are crucial components of web development outsourcing contracts.…
Q: simple table of examples in some domain, such as classifying animals by species, and trace the…
A: The question requests the creation of a dataset in a specific domain (e.g., animals classified by…
Q: How does the emergence of progressive web apps (PWAs) influence the development and maintenance…
A: In this question we have to understand about the emergence of progressive web apps (PWAs) influence…
Q: Define web outsourcing and explain the reasons why organizations choose to outsource the development…
A: Web outsourcing is an approach used by companies to delegate the development and ongoing upkeep of…
Q: What are the key considerations for software product deployment and release management?
A: Software development is the imaginative process of creating, constructing, and fine-tuning computer…
Q: Explain the role of front-end and back-end development in the development phase of a web project.
A: The process of building and managing websites or online apps is known as web development. In order…
Q: How does scope creep affect the project timeline and budget in web development projects?
A: 1) Scope creep refers to the gradual, uncontrolled expansion or addition of features,…
Q: How does continuous integration/continuous deployment (CI/CD) impact the development and release of…
A: Continuous Integration/Continuous Deployment (CI/CD) is a collection of software engineering…
Q: xplain the OSI (Open Systems Interconnection) model and its seven layers. Provide examples of…
A: The OSI (Open Systems Interconnection) model is a fundamental framework in networking that…
Q: ps in the context of website development outsourcing. How can DevOps practices improve the…
A: DevOps is an approach that brings together the worlds of development and operations to improve…
Q: What are some of the emerging trends and technologies in web development, such as Progressive Web…
A: 1) Web development refers to the process of creating and building websites or web applications that…
Q: What is the purpose of input and output devices in a computer system? Provide examples of each.
A: Input and output devices are components of a computer system as they ease communication, between…
Q: Describe the binary number system and its significance in digital computing.
A: The use of digital electrical circuits and systems to carry out computations, process data, and…
Q: Discuss the concept of continuous integration/continuous deployment (CI/CD) and its application in…
A: Continuous Integration/Continuous Deployment (CI/CD) is a set of modern software development…
Q: What is the role of quality assurance and testing in ensuring a high-quality software product?
A: In software development, testing and quality assurance are components that contribute significantly…
Q: How does a cache memory system enhance the performance of a computer?
A: Hello studentCache memory plays a crucial role in enhancing a computer's performance by bridging the…
Q: Discuss the importance of user feedback during the deployment phase of web development
A: Web development is the process of creating, building, and maintaining websites and web applications…
Q: Describe the functioning of ICMP (Internet Control Message Protocol) and its various message types…
A: An IP (Internet Protocol) suite network layer protocol is called ICMP (Internet Control Message…
Q: Explain the concept of microservices architecture and its advantages in building scalable software…
A: The concept of microservices architecture is an approach to software development. It involves…
Q: Discuss the concept of NAT (Network Address Translation) and its use in private and public IP…
A: The necessity to maximize and manage the finite number of accessible IP addresses emerged as the…
Q: How can web development teams effectively manage cross-browser compatibility and ensure consistent…
A: Web development is the practice of designing, constructing, and upkeeping websites and web…
Q: Describe the concept of software maintenance and its significance for software products.
A: Software Maintenance: Ensuring the Longevity and Reliability of Software ProductsSoftware…
Q: What is the role of quality assurance and testing in ensuring the reliability of software products?
A: In the field of software development, coming up with a product is only half the fight. Making sure…
Q: Explain the challenges and strategies associated with scaling a software product to handle increased…
A: When it comes to scaling a software product to manage users there are important considerations in…
Q: using loops in C++ Write a program that will predict the size of a population of organisms. The…
A: In this question we have to write a C++ programLet's code and hope this helkps, If you find any…
Q: Discuss the challenges and benefits of transitioning from a monolithic software architecture to a…
A: Transitioning from a monolithic software architecture to a microservices-based architecture can…
Explain the importance of quality assurance and testing in software product development.
Step by step
Solved in 3 steps
- Explain the significance of software testing and quality assurance in the development process.Briefly explain what happens during the software quality review process and the software quality inspection process.Describe the purpose of unit testing in software development and its role in ensuring code quality.
- Explain the importance of automated testing in the software development process. What types of tests can be automated, and what are the benefits?Explain the various testing procedures used in the software engineering field.Explain the concept of software testing and quality assurance in software development. Describe various testing methodologies and when to apply them.
- Describe the Software Development Life Cycle (SDLC) and its role in ensuring software quality. Explain the phases of SDLC and how quality is managed throughout the process.Explain the key principles of software testing and the various stages of the software testing life cycle.Explain the many software testing methods that are utilised in the creation of software.